The Snapper 36" lawn mower features a robust engine, adjustable cutting height, and a wide cutting deck for efficient grass cutting. It is equipped with a mulching capability, side discharge, and a rear bagging option for versatile lawn care.
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Engine | Powerful 12.5 HP engine for reliable performance |
| Cutting Width | 36 inches for efficient mowing |
| Cutting Height Adjustment | 5 positions for customized grass length |
| Mulching Capability | Efficient grass recycling for a healthy lawn |
| Rear Bagging | Collects clippings for easy disposal |
| Side Discharge | Discharges clippings to the side for quick mowing |

| Symptom | Possible Cause | Corrective Action |
|---|---|---|
| Engine won't start | Fuel issue | Check fuel level and quality; ensure choke is set correctly. |
| Uneven cutting | Blade issue | Sharpen or replace blades; check tire pressure. |
| Excessive vibration | Loose parts | Tighten all screws and bolts; inspect for damage. |
| Clippings not bagging | Clogged chute | Clear any debris from the discharge chute. |
